Reduced Diabetes Burden Over Glycemic Gains With the Dexcom G7 Upgrade in Youth on Automated Insulin Delivery System

Franceschi, Roberto;Cavalli, Claudio;Marigliano, Marco;
2026-01-01

Abstract

Switching from Dexcom G6 to G7 in high-performing youth using the Tandem Control-­ IQ system is observed with modest but significant improvements in both system usability and glycemic outcomes, associated with increased TCL. Importantly, these technological benefits were associated with a markedly improved user experience. Our findings suggest that the primary value of this upgrade lies in reducing the daily burden of diabetes management, highlighting the critical importance of user-­ centric design in paediatric diabetes technology
